Verizon continues industry-leading LTE Advanced network deployments

Customers in more than 1,100 markets can now access the powerful combination of 4x4 MIMO antenna tech, 256 QAM and carrier aggregation.


BASKING RIDGE, NJ  – WEBWIRE

Verizon continues to aggressively deploy the latest 4G LTE Advanced technologies that provide significantly faster peak data speeds and capacity for customers.

Verizon customers in more than 2,000 markets can access the benefits of carrier aggregation and those in 1,100 markets can access 4x4 MIMO (Massive Input, Massive Output) and 256 QAM (Quadrature Amplitude Modulation) in addition to carrier aggregation. In combination, these three technologies drastically impact the capacity available for customers to use the Verizon network and the speed at which their data sessions are completed. 

These three advanced technologies hold the key to significantly greater efficiency/capacity gains and speed boosts on the LTE network.

  • Carrier aggregation combines discreet bands of spectrum so data can flow between the bands more efficiently.
  • 4x4 MIMO uses an increased number of antennas at the cell tower and on customers’ devices to minimize interference when transmitting data.
  • 256 QAM enables customers’ devices and the network to exchange information in larger amounts delivering more bits of data in each transmission.
